Job overview
Applications are invited from candidates for a 6-month Core Trainee Locum Appointment in Service post in Psychiatry. The post is ideally suited to an individual who has satisfactorily completed Foundation Year 1/2 training and has 4 months psychiatry experience, and is considering a career in Psychiatry.
All applicants must hold full registration and license with the General Medical Council.
Main duties of the job
The post holder will be working with a team that may consist of Consultants, Specialty Doctors, Trust Doctors, Higher Specialty Trainees, Core Trainees, GP Trainees and Foundation Trainees. The post will have a generic clinical component in the relevant area. The post holder will have the relevant experience in psychiatry, required for the level of the trainee vacancy, including the assessment and management of acutely unwell psychiatric patients, provide essential medical care, assessing patient history and mental state, outpatient clinics, ward cover, in-patient reviews and procedures, audit and research.
This post includes being apart of the first on call resident rota.
